What advice would you give couples when choosing their wedding photographer?
Find the right style for you and the right person, remember you have to spend all day with them! I know most brides are on a budget, but selecting someone because of their price, rather than them and their work is a risky business. As part of my job at WEDDING magazine I see a lot of photos and it is heart breaking to see a wedding which is obviously had so much work put into it but the photos dont do it justice

What advice would you give couples when choosing their wedding photographer?
I know it can be very hard and the choice can be overwhelming. Start wide and narrow down your search to those photographers whose work you like. Read about them and try to understand who they are. Do they appeal to you as a person? It’s really important for both a client and a photographer to ‘click’ as you will spend a good few hours together before the wedding, during the wedding and after. So, select a few whose work you like and who you think you like as a person, and arrange a meeting. While talking face to face you will understand if you want to work together. It’s like that feeling, you’ll know when it’s ‘the one’! Don’t hesitate to ask any questions you may have. You should be confident in your photographer to capture all the important moments. A good photographer will make you feel relaxed and will let you know that he/she knows their craft, knows what they are doing on the wedding day, and you will get beautiful images.
